Allie Clifton
Allie Clifton, a sports broadcaster with Spectrum Sports Net, is at the end of her fifth year with the Los Angeles Lakers. As a sports broadcaster, Allie has been awarded a 5x Emmy Winner, has over 10 years of experience as a sideline and sports reporter. She has over 10 years of experience playing competitive basketball. Allie was a reporter for sports and reporter for feature stories at ABC Action News 13 (WTVG) in addition to being a sideline and color analyst in the broadcasting of Buckeye Sports' high school, collegiate and college basketball, volleyball, and track and field. Clifton is a native of Ohio, graduated with Bachelor's and Master's degrees from The University of Toledo in Sport Analysis and Communication and Liberal Studies. After a successful high school basketball career during her time at Van Wert High School, where she was captain of the one and only league title team from her school. Allie had a successful basketball career while at UT. In 2010, she was captain of the team, a member of the Mid-American Conference West Division, to win the title.
